首页 > Web开发 > 详细

Web开发笔记 #07# Swagger Editor

时间:2018-12-05 15:19:37      阅读:157      评论:0      收藏:0      [点我收藏+]

Swagger Editor是一款可以用yaml格式文本设计、可视化、测试RESTful API的工具,并且能够实时看到自动生成的文档。效果大概是这样的↓

技术分享图片

根据官方网站介绍,如果是团队的话,建议用在线的SwaggerHub(似乎是有很多便于开发的套件);个人solo开发则建议下载本地的Swagger Editor。

因为不熟悉Node.js,所以简单记录一下安装流程:

1、首先需要安装Node.js的尽可能新的版本,这个时候npm也会一起配套安装好。直接去官方网站下载就行了。

2、来到Swagger Editor的github页面把压缩包下载到本地(或者clone)

3、解压到文件夹,这个时候可以看到有个index.html文件,直接点开就能用了,并且编辑之后直接关闭也不会丢失数据(保存在浏览器的本地存储中)

另外一种方法是启动静态服务器来打开编辑器,这需要做一些额外工作:

1、运行命令:npm install -g http-server (安装一个类似web容器的东西)

2、用安装好的工具启动静态服务器访问Swagger Editor。命令行切换到有index.html的那个目录下,运行命令:http-server -p 端口号

技术分享图片

技术分享图片

 

Web开发笔记 #07# Swagger Editor

原文:https://www.cnblogs.com/xkxf/p/10070725.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!